Elevate your wedding style with the Lisianthus & Anemone Groom Buttonhole from Alperton Florist. Handcrafted in Alperton, this elegant buttonhole is designed for grooms who want a refined, modern look that photographs beautifully and lasts throughout the big day. Featuring delicate white lisianthus, crisp white veronica, and rich purple anemone, each piece offers a striking contrast of colour and texture. Bear grass adds a contemporary, structured finish for a polished, premium feel.

Perfect for classic, modern, or romantic wedding themes, this groom buttonhole coordinates effortlessly with bridal bouquets and bridesmaids' flowers. The set includes 4 matching buttonholes, ideal for the groom, best man, and groomsmen, ensuring a cohesive look for your wedding party.
